Here’s how I made the squash:

Squash marinating in italion dressing
I sliced in into 1/4″ planks, marinated it in my favorite dressing for 5 hours (I marinated chicken breasts in the same dressing). Then I grilled the planks over direct medium heat for 5 minutes a side. Here is the end result:
